About this product

Product Information

Step into the realistic arenas of NHL 07 to take the role of both player and general manager. The game features a career-like "Dynasty" mode in which you must negotiate contracts, set salaries, and trade team members as the general manager. On the ice, with the help of an improved game engine, teammates display more realistic movements and position-specific behavior. For example, an offensive defensemen will act and play differently than a sniper or power forward.<br><br>As your team gains experience, rookies' skills and abilities will increase and veterans can help maintain good morale. Commentary, including ever-changing storylines and team rivalries, is provided by Gary Thorne and Bill Clement. The returning "Skill Stick" feature allows you to snap a quick wrister, pull back for a slap shot, or move the puck to the left or right to deke defenders and goalies.

  • Mediocre, but still fun

    NHL 07 on Playstation 2 is an okay hockey game. On the XBOX 360 version of this game, commentary comes from Gary Thorne and Bill Clement, who were great announcers when working with ESPN and ABC. Instead of those two, we get okay Play-by-Play commentary from Jim Hughson and Craig Simpson. They're not bad, but compared to Gary and Bill, they're quite dull. As far as gameplay goes, when you first play the game, it will feel like the controls are slippery. If you want to make a hit, you have to be extremely accurate in checking your opponent; several times, you will end up missing an opponent on a one-on-one situation and give your opponent a breakaway chance.   • NHL 07 or NHL 06?

    NHL 07... or NHL 06? It's a decent game but it doesn't grow on past successes, that makes it a let down for me. The Demo Video said the game would change the way you look at NHL video games. All new controls, better goaltenders, no speed burst, realistic puck movement, super intense dynasty mode and much more... What the Demo video forgot to mention was that all of this was only available on the X-Box 360. There is no dual joystick puck control, the right joystick is now used for passing the puck, which I actually enjoy, but it isn't a necessary change to the game. The goaltenders are a little better, as they do not flop around like they did in 06, there is still speed burst just like in 06.
